Honda recalls 330K vehicles over mirror problem.

TL;DR Summary
Honda is recalling over 330,000 vehicles, including the Odyssey, Passport, Pilot, and Ridgeline models, due to a mirror issue that could increase the risk of a crash. The heating pads behind both side-view mirrors may not be bonded properly, causing the mirror glass to fall out. Honda dealers will replace the side-view mirrors on impacted vehicles free of charge, and owner notification letters are expected to be sent out on May 8.
